
Duc Nam was the first to score for CAND 2 in the 13th minute with an accurate header after a cross from Mai Tien Thanh. With the strongest squad on the field, the Vietnamese representative created an attractive attacking game with their opponent.
After the goal, Thailand pushed up their attacking formation to put pressure in search of an equalizer. The away team succeeded in equalizing the score in the 34th minute, also from an aerial situation.
Entering the second half, the match continued to be open with many situations of "tit for tat" between the two sides. The 2-1 victory was decided for CAND 2 in the 50th minute and the scorer was Nhu Tuan with a rebound kick from a narrow angle.
In the semi-final 1 that took place earlier, Cambodia and Timor Leste also created a spectacular chase, ending in a 2-2 draw after 90 minutes of official play. The two teams had to take each other to the penalty shootout to decide the winner, and in this match, Cambodia won 11-10.
With the above results, CAND 2 will meet Cambodia in the final match of the 2025 ASEAN Police Open tournament taking place at 8:00 p.m. on July 15 at Hang Day Stadium.
